The Duty of Court Reporters in Legal Proceedings
When you step into a court, you could not understand just how vital stenotype reporter are to the lawful procedure. These specialists sit quietly, catching every word spoken throughout proceedings, from witness statements to lawyers' arguments. They utilize specialized equipment to produce accurate, verbatim records that act as essential records of the case.
Stenotype reporter assure that all parties have accessibility to a precise account of what taken place, which is essential for allures and future referrals. You could not think of it, however their work supports the transparency of the judicial system, permitting discretionary to make enlightened choices based upon clear proof.

Stenography Machines Evolution
As innovation breakthroughs, stenography makers have actually advanced considerably, enhancing the way court press reporters record talked words. These devices utilize multiple keys that enable you to kind whole expressions at when, noticeably increasing transcription rate and precision. Additionally, advancements in software have actually enhanced the combination of these devices with digital devices, better simplifying the transcription procedure.

What Qualifications Are Required to Come To Be a Stenotype Reporter?
To become a stenotype reporter, you'll need a secondary school diploma, specialized training in court coverage, and typically an accreditation or permit - court reporting. Solid typing skills and interest to information are important for success in this area

What Is the Typical Wage of a Stenotype Reporter?

The typical salary of a stenotype reporter differs, but it normally varies from $50,000 to $80,000 annually. Factors like location, experience, and expertise can substantially affect your gaining possibility in this career.
